Soul & Surf support us through 1% For The Planet, helping us to grow and develop our charity and work with more communities to protect our coastline.

 “We support SAS because our coastline matters. It’s where we spend our leisure time; it’s also where lots of us work. SAS ensures that we as an island nation don’t become complacent about such an important resource.” – Ed Templeton, Owner Soul & Surf

We set up shop in 2010 to offer an alternative to the pile ‘em high sell ’em cheap surf camps. We choose original locations, we set our standards high, we hire brilliant staff and we offer so much more than just surf lessons and surf guides. Our yoga, pranayama, meditation, therapies, cafe and music programmes are not just hastily bolted on to tick the marketing boxes, they are the Soul of Soul & Surf. And we work hard to present this all in a very down to earth way so it seems like we don’t work too hard. The result is that we‘re not really sure what to label ourselves. We’re not really a surf camp, we’re not serious enough to call ourselves a (Surf & Yoga) Retreat, or a Wellness Retreat. I guess we’re just a bunch of feel-good people who like some Soul with their Surf, or some Surf with their Soul.

In 2009, Ed & Sofie Templeton gave up their jobs in Brighton, UK to set off on a round the world surf & yoga adventure. Since then we’ve gathered a bunch of like-minded people from around the world to join us on this trip. Soul & Surf is the result.
